Commit 3607308f authored by Gyuyoung Kim's avatar Gyuyoung Kim Committed by Commit Bot

[css-grid] Migrate grid-container-scroll-accounts-for-sizing.html to WPT

This CL migrates grid-container-scroll-accounts-for-sizing.html
from fast/css-grid-layout to
external/wpt/css/css-grid/grid-model with WPT styles,
adding links to the relevant specs, and test description.

Additionally, this test is renamed to
grid-container-scrollbars-sizing-001.html to be aligned with
existing tests.

Bug: 1063749
Change-Id: I370f3a02a7d5aac8bcfad2544447e1fe046b7a13
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/2153453
Commit-Queue: Gyuyoung Kim <gyuyoung@igalia.com>
Reviewed-by: default avatarManuel Rego <rego@igalia.com>
Cr-Commit-Position: refs/heads/master@{#760294}
parent 58be7c08
<!DOCTYPE html>
<title>CSS Grid Layout Test: Grid container's height with scrollbars</title>
<link rel="author" title="Javier Fernandez Garcia-Boente" href="mailto:jfernandez@igalia.com">
<link rel="help" href="https://drafts.csswg.org/css-grid/#overflow"/>
<link rel="issue" href="https://bugs.chromium.org/p/chromium/issues/detail?id=583743"/>
<link rel="match" href="../reference/grid-container-scrollbars-sizing-001-ref.html">
<meta name="assert" content="This test ensures that the grid container considers the scrollbar when computing the logical height."/>
<style>
html {
overflow-x: scroll;
}
.grid {
display: grid;
float: left;
overflow-y: scroll;
overflow-x: scroll;
}
.item {
background: lime;
width: 100px;
height: 100px;
}
</style>
<p>This test passes if you see a 100x100px green box and scrollbars are disabled.</p>
<div class="grid">
<div class="item">item</div>
</div>
<!DOCTYPE html>
<style>
html {
overflow-x: scroll;
}
.grid {
display: grid;
width: fit-content;
overflow-y: scroll;
overflow-x: scroll;
}
.item {
background: lime;
width: 100px;
height: 100px;
}
</style>
<p>This test passes if you see a 100x100px green box and scrollbars are disabled.</p>
<div class="grid">
<div class="item">item</div>
</div>
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ment